Photo A Day-Worlds Smallest Fish

by 100299 on May 16, 2012

Website: http://www.oddee.com/item_96492.aspx

This is the world smallest fish. It was on January 2006, the world smallest fish was discovered Indonesian island of Sumatra. It is a family member of the carp family, it’s scientific name is Paedocypris progenetica. More shocking is it has a backbone, when it’s only 7.9mm which is 0.3 of  an inch. How small is that!
